Transaction 164fc860a4f55e2428102af227a97e0b943674a13be0738b5a8ce30d7a60965f
1 Input
1 Output
-
164fc860a4f55e2428102af227a97e0b943674a13be0738b5a8ce30d7a60965f:0
- value
- 1537300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fdb7e926f3e073d78bdda4e030585294a92f2992 OP_EQUAL
- address
- 3QpZCRJY4NDCiWorxfinXn7SqMsLSb2Lmb